Output 2aec7a32f7656bd368df1bf5ea335ac1dd577048d95cb6b84781b9e2652319b7:2

value
200000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 786c5e5bf3c8152eacdf53fb60b3a617f66498b5 OP_EQUAL
address
3Cfkq9NJXh8yTmdSN7whQvXLkqbSjXRvts
transaction
2aec7a32f7656bd368df1bf5ea335ac1dd577048d95cb6b84781b9e2652319b7
confirmations
321406
spent
true